Abstract
The rapid development of information technology has brought tremendous changes to the operation of all industries, which is usually referred to as digital transformation. In response to the huge demand for new talents under such transformation, reviewing the current training system in colleges and universities and revising the teaching content and evaluation methods are important and urgent issues. On the other hand, intelligent education is considered as a new teaching paradigm, which aims to improve education quality, expand education scale and promote education equity by leveraging information technologies. In this paper, we demonstrate our recent effort in constructing a new generation of intelligent education platform for computer science education, and discuss the key role of computational pedagogy in transforming the traditional teaching methods. We summarize our experience and the best practice in computer science education with the platform, and hope to deliver some insight to the educators.
